Privacy Fence Construction in Waukesha, WI
Privacy fence construction services involve installing fences that create a secluded and secure boundary around residential properties. These projects typically include building fences using materials such as wood, vinyl, or composite, tailored to provide privacy and enhance the aesthetic appeal of a home. Property owners often request privacy fences to define property lines, increase security, reduce noise, or improve outdoor privacy for activities like relaxing, entertaining, or playing in the yard.
Before requesting privacy fence construction, property owners usually want to understand the available materials, design options, and any local regulations or property restrictions. It’s also helpful to consider the desired height and style of the fence, as well as the overall maintenance requirements. Clarifying these details can ensure the completed fence meets both functional needs and personal preferences, creating a private outdoor space that complements the property.

Common Privacy Fence Construction Jobs
Privacy Fence Construction - provides a secure and enclosed space for outdoor activities.
Wood Privacy Fences - offer natural appearance and customizable height options.
Vinyl Privacy Fences - deliver low-maintenance, durable barriers for added privacy.
Chain-Link Privacy Fences - combine security with privacy using slats or screens.
Fence Extensions and Enclosures - expand existing fences for increased privacy and security.
Custom Privacy Fence Design - allows for tailored solutions to match property style and needs.
Privacy Fence Construction Questions
What types of privacy fences are commonly built? Common options include wood, vinyl, and composite fences, each offering different levels of privacy and durability.
How tall can a privacy fence be? Privacy fences typically range from 6 to 8 feet in height, depending on local regulations and property restrictions.
What should property owners consider before installing a privacy fence? It's important to check property lines, local regulations, and any HOA guidelines before beginning construction.
Can privacy fences be customized to match property styles? Yes, privacy fences can be customized with various styles, finishes, and colors to complement different property aesthetics.
